On the identification of a rigid body immersed in a fluid: A numerical approach
Abstract
This work deals with the study of an inverse geometric problem in fluid mechanics. In particular, we are interested in the numerical reconstruction of a rigid body which is immersed in a cavity, filled with a fluid, by means of measurements of the Cauchy forces and the velocity of the fluid on one part of the exterior boundary. This problem was studied in [Alvarez C, Conca C, Friz L, Kavian L, Ortega JH. Identification of immersed obstacles via boundary measurements. Inverse Problems 2005; 21:1531-52], where the authors proved the identifiability and stability for this problem. In this work we present a numerical method for the reconstruction of the rigid body for some particular geometries. © 2008 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
